`
张玉龙
  • 浏览: 722051 次
  • 性别: Icon_minigender_1
  • 来自: 沈阳
社区版块
存档分类
最新评论

document.createElement(div)动态生成层方法

阅读更多
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>无标题文档</title>
<script language="javascript1.2">
function Button1_onclick() //直接采用代码建立一个DIV
{
    var newElement = document.createElement("div"); 
    var newText = document.createTextNode("这是新建立 div 中的文字。"); 
    document.body.appendChild(newElement); 
    newElement.id = "newDiv"; 
    newElement.className = "newDivClass"; 
    newElement.setAttribute("name","newDivName"); 
    newElement.style.width = "300px"; 
    newElement.style.height = "200px"; 
    newElement.style.margin = "0 auto"; 
    newElement.style.border = "1px solid #DDD"; 
    newElement.appendChild(newText);  

}
  

</script>

</head>

<body onload="Button1_onclick()">
</body>
</html>
分享到:
评论

相关推荐

    vue动态生成dom并且自动绑定事件

    用jquery的时候你会发现,页面渲染后动态生成的dom,在生成之前的代码是没办法取到相应对象的,必须重新获取.但是vue基于数据绑定的特性让它能生成的时候直接绑定数据。 html: &lt;div id=app&gt; &lt;input type=...

    bug解决思路.txt

    var span1=document.createElement("span"); span1.innerText="..."; span1.setAttribute("id","span1"); yema.appendChild(span1);//生成省略号,根据情况进行判断显示与否 for (var i = 3; i ; i++) { var p...

    javascript生成img标签的3种实现方法(对象、方法、html)

    本文实例讲述了javascript生成img标签的3种实现方法。分享给大家供大家参考,具体如下: &lt;div id=d1&gt;&lt;/div&gt; [removed] //HTML function a(){ document.getElementById(d1)[removed]=&lt;img src='http://baike.baidu....

    html2canvas把div保存图片高清图的方法示例

    本文介绍了html2canvas把div保存图片高清图的方法示例,分享给大家,具体如下: ...默认生成的 canvas 图片在 retina 设备上显示很模糊,处理成 2 倍图能解决这个问题: ...var canvas = document.createElement(canva

    用js动态添加html元素,以及属性的简单实例

    var lswt_2=document.createElement("div"); //设置节点id lswt_2.id='lswtColse'; //设置节点属性 lswt_2.style.width='11px'; lswt_2.style.height='10px'; lswt_2.style.top='0px'; lswt_2.style.right='0px'; ...

    网页下载文件期间如何防止用户对网页进行其他操作

    做网页下载文件时,有时候文件过大,生成文件需要一段时间...var bgObj=document.createElement("div"); bgObj.setAttribute('id','bgDiv'); bgObj.style.position="absolute"; bgObj.style.top="0"; bgObj.style.backg

    Xpage学习笔记

    var pane = document.createElement("div"); pane.innerHTML = "&lt;span&gt;Hello Dojo!&lt;/span&gt;"; dia.setContent(pane); dia.show(); } function btnDemo(){ var dojoBtn = dijit.byId("dojoBtn"); var ...

    小球随机生成掉落弹起

    小球随机生成掉落弹起 DOM随机生成一个随机x轴的随机色的小球来回弹 Document var speed = 1; var y = -50; function init() { ... var div = document.createElement(div); Object.assign(div.style

    素描

    ) 按钮将需要通过addEventListener运行,其中函数将重新加载页面,然后生成提示以显示网格大小带有悬停事件的DOM可能应该改变颜色记住,要创建和元素,必须先创建.createElement,然后再创建parent.appendChild...

    JavaScript 进度条实现代码(Firefox等相似浏览器下不支持)

    代码如下:[code] [removed] var loading = { element: null, count: 0, ID: 0, createLoading: function(parent, width, height){ //用于生成外围的进度条框 loading.element = document.createElement(“div”);...

    webpack教程之webpack.config.js配置文件

    首先我们需要安装一个webpack插件html-webpack-plugin,该插件的作用是帮助我们生成创建... const element=document.createElement('div'); element[removed]=text; return element; } 在根目录下创建webpack.confi

    影藏秘密到图片

    var gads document createElement &quot;script&quot; ; gads async true; gads type &quot;text javascript&quot;; var useSSL &quot;https:&quot; document location protocol; gads src useSSL &quot;https:&quot...

    俄罗斯方块

    tetris_canvas = document.createElement("canvas"); // 设置canvas组件的高度、宽度 tetris_canvas.width = cols * cellWidth; tetris_canvas.height = rows * cellHeight; // 设置canvas组件的边框 tetris_...

Global site tag (gtag.js) - Google Analytics